Method create_user_memory_region

hypervisor/src/kvm/mod.rs:1008–1114  ·  view source on GitHub ↗

Creates a guest physical memory region. # Safety `userspace_addr` must point to `memory_size` bytes of memory that will stay mapped until a successful call to `remove_user_memory_region().` Freeing them with `munmap()` before then will cause undefined guest behavior but at least should not cause undefined behavior in the host. In theory, at least.
